Question 1
Which anatomical position is considered the universal reference
point for describing body structures?


A) Standing with arms crossed over the chest
B) Standing upright, facing forward, arms at the sides, palms facing
forward
C) Sitting upright with hands on the knees
D) Lying flat on the back


CORRECT ANSWER: B – Standing upright, facing forward, arms
at the sides, palms facing forward


Rationale: The anatomical position is the standard reference
position used worldwide to describe body locations consistently.

,In this position, the body stands upright, faces forward, with arms
at the sides and palms facing forward.


Question 2
What is the definition of anatomy?


A) The study of the functions of living organisms
B) The science of the STRUCTURE of an organism and the
relationship of its parts
C) The study of disease processes
D) The study of chemical reactions in the body


CORRECT ANSWER: B – The science of the STRUCTURE of an
organism and the relationship of its parts


Rationale: Anatomy is defined as the science of the STRUCTURE
of an organism and the relationship of its parts. Physiology, in
contrast, is the science of the functions of organisms.


Question 3
What is the definition of physiology?


A) The study of the structure of the body

,B) The study of the functions of living organisms and their parts
C) The study of tissues
D) The study of cells


CORRECT ANSWER: B – The study of the functions of living
organisms and their parts


Rationale: Physiology is the study of how the body parts function.
Anatomy and physiology are closely related because structure
often determines function.


Question 4
The term "superior" refers to a structure that is:


A) Closer to the feet
B) Above another structure
C) Toward the back
D) Away from the midline


CORRECT ANSWER: B – Above another structure

, Rationale: Superior means toward the head or upper part of the
body, indicating a structure located above another.


Question 5
The term "inferior" means:


A) Toward the head
B) Toward the midline
C) Away from the surface
D) Toward the feet


CORRECT ANSWER: D – Toward the feet


Rationale: Inferior (caudal) means toward the feet or lower part of
the body. Superior (cranial) means toward the head or upper part
of the body.
